Factors Affecting Cost

House raising in Union, KY, involves elevating a structure to protect it from flooding, improve foundation stability, or comply with local regulations. The scope and complexity of these projects can vary based on several factors, helping homeowners understand typical considerations and project components.

  • Materials involved: The process typically requires durable framing components, foundation supports, and sometimes additional reinforcements, depending on the house size and existing structure.
  • Size and scope: The scope ranges from small single-story homes to larger multi-story structures, affecting the overall complexity and duration of the project.
  • Labor complexity: House raising involves careful planning, precise lifting techniques, and coordination of multiple trades, which can influence labor requirements.
  • Permitting considerations: Local permits are generally required to ensure compliance with building codes and floodplain regulations in Union, KY.
  • Additional services and extras: Options may include foundation repairs, utility disconnects and reconnects, and structural modifications to meet new elevation standards.
